"Creators of great Mayan civilizations that began 3000 years ago, still live in the face of this woman, one of the remaining 280 Lacandons of Chiapas". May be considered as living reliefs, so much do they resemble pre-Hispanic Mayan stelae figures. The Lacandon have lived in the forest for centuries and have evolved production systems and ways of life that maintain the integrity of the natural environment. At one time they hunted and farmed in an unbroken, high canopied forest.
